Pastor Dan Darrikhuma immigrated with his parents and brothers from Mizoram in Northeast India in 1964. He grew up in Maryland and attended Seventh-day Adventist schools from first grade through seminary. He is a US Army veteran where he served as an infantryman and paratrooper.

As a pastor, he spent his first fifteen years in children’s and youth ministry. He then pastored a rural, three-church district, a small town church, and he now pastors the Waldorf SDA Church just outside of Washington, DC. He is passionate about seeing his members inspired and empowered to minister using their spiritual gifts. He is also the leader in the Brandywine, MD church plant.

His wife Donna and he are empty nesters, but enjoy their vacations with their three children, six grandchildren, and one great grandchild. At home they enjoy the company of their rescued Chihuahuas (Tinkerbelle and Chico) and Russian Blue cat, Comet. After family and ministry, Dan is passionate about playing his accordion which he has done for 47 years.
